Proverbs 21:6

“The getting of treasures by a lying tongue is a vanity tossed to and fro of them that seek death.”

King James Version (KJV)

Other Translations

The getting of treasures by a lying tongue, is a vanitie tossed to and fro of them that seeke death.
- King James Version (1611) - View 1611 Bible Scan

The acquisition of treasures by a lying tongue Is a fleeting vapor, the pursuit of death.
- New American Standard Version (1995)

The getting of treasures by a lying tongue Is a vapor driven to and fro by them that seek death.
- American Standard Version (1901)

He who gets stores of wealth by a false tongue, is going after what is only breath, and searching for death.
- Basic English Bible

The getting of treasures by a lying tongue is a fleeting breath of them that seek death.
- Darby Bible

The getting of treasures by a lying tongue is a vanity tossed to and fro by them that seek death.
- Webster's Bible

Getting treasures by a lying tongue is a fleeting vapor for those who seek death.
- World English Bible

The making of treasures by a lying tongue, [Is] a vanity driven away of those seeking death.
- Youngs Literal Bible

The getting of treasures by a lying tongue is a vapour driven to and fro; they that seek them seek death.
- Jewish Publication Society Bible

Wesley's Notes for Proverbs 21:6


21:6 Lying tongue - By any false or deceitful words or actions. Is tossed - Is like the chaff or smoak driven away by the wind. Of them - That take those courses which will bring destruction upon them.
